What kind of animal is the snipe hunt?
According to American Folklore: An Encyclopedia: Although snipe hunting is known in virtually every part of the United States, descriptions of prey vary — it can be described as a bird, snake, or small animal.

What does a Snipe bird eat?
The shy and reserved bird has rather pointed wings, a long bill and striped plumage, which allows it to camouflage itself effectively among vegetation. Insects, especially fly and beetle larvae, are the main food for snipe, but they also feed on earthworms, small crustaceans, snails and small amounts of vegetable matter.

Where do snipe come from to hunt in Kansas?
Common snipe breeds in Canada and the northern states. It starts coming to Kansas in late summer and can stay there all winter. Cheyenne Bottoms and other shallow swamps are the prime hunting grounds for snipe in Kansas. Snipe hunting is physically difficult as hunters often wade or traverse muddy areas to hunt for snipe.

Can a snipe be hunted in North America?
The snipe is probably the least known and least used wild bird in North America. This is just one of two waders that can be legally hunted under the Migratory Bird Act, the other being a woodcock.
